Beau’s lines on a nail

Posted on April 20, 2026 by Admin

Beau’s lines are horizontal indentations or ridges that run across the nail plate. They can appear on fingernails or toenails and usually indicate that something temporarily interrupted nail growth.


🧠 What Beau’s lines look like

  • Horizontal grooves across the nail
  • Can be shallow or deep
  • May appear on one or multiple nails
  • Move outward as the nail grows

⚠️ Common causes

Beau’s lines are not a disease themselves—they are a sign of past stress on the body, such as:

  • Severe illness or high fever
  • Infections (like flu or COVID-19)
  • Major surgery or injury
  • Severe stress or malnutrition
  • Uncontrolled diabetes
  • Chemotherapy or certain medications

🧬 What they mean

  • They show that nail growth temporarily stopped
  • The position of the line can help estimate when the stress event happened
  • Usually harmless once the cause is resolved

⏳ Do they go away?

  • Yes, but slowly
  • Nails grow out over weeks to months
  • No permanent damage in most cases

🚨 When to see a doctor

  • If many nails are affected
  • If lines appear repeatedly without clear reason
  • If there are other symptoms (fatigue, weight loss, illness signs)

✔️ Bottom line

Beau’s lines are horizontal nail grooves caused by a temporary disruption in nail growth, often linked to illness or physical stress, and usually improve as the nail grows out.
